Provide individual training focused on basic living skills development, psychosocial skills training, and therapeutic socialization. Work across various settings to support individuals with serious mental illness or co-occurring disorders.
Requires a Bachelor's degree in a related field, or an Associate's/High School diploma with corresponding years of experience, plus one year of experience with SMI populations. Alternatively, candidates may qualify as a Certified Peer Specialist with state certification.
